Key to Iridothrips species (females)
[* based on description]
1. Pronotum with 2 pairs of posteromarginal setae (Fig. 8); postocular setal pair I and pair II usually absent.................................................................................................... zizaniophila comb. n.
-. Pronotum with 4–5 pairs of posteromarginal setae (Fig. 13); postocular setal pair I and pair II usually present, occasionally pair I missing............................................................................................ 2
2. Ocellar setae I absent, cheeks convergent posteriorly (Fig. 5) [abdominal tergites posterior margin with short irregular dentiform lobes laterally, tergite VIII with complete comb (Fig. 25); sternites without obvious posteromarginal lobes].... mariae
-. Ocellar setae I present, cheeks parallel (Fig. 7).............................................................. 3
3. Pronotum anteroangular setae rather short, shorter than submedian anteromarginal setae............ kratochvili comb. n. *
-. Pronotum anteroangular setae rather long, at least longer than submedian anteromarginal setae........................ 4
4. Mesosternal endofurca without spinula; mesonotum median setae situated in the middle of the sclerite; metanotal median setae near anterior margin (Fig. 17); tergites and sternites posterior margins without craspeda or teeth; tergite VIII posterior margin without comb..................................................................................... iridis
-. Mesosternal endofurca with spinula; mesonotum median setae close to posterior margin; metanotal median setae well behind anterior margin (Fig. 18); tergites and sternites posterior margin with craspeda or teeth; tergite VIII posterior margin with short teeth arising from lobes (Fig. 21).............................................................. lobulatus sp. n.
